26TH Jan 2013:
Rehab India Foundation celebrated Republic Day of India to commemorate the date
and the moment when the Constitution of India came into effect on 26th January
2013 at Head Quarter and its regional offices.
The Day was celebrated
with much enthusiasm at Jasola Vihar, New Delhi, Gourhar Village, Uttar
Pradesh, Holagunda, Andhra Pradesh, Nizamudheen Colony, Andhra Pradesh,
Nandamuri Nagar, Andhra Pradesh, Vallinokkam, Tamil Nadu, and Solva Village,
West Bengal. The programme was started with the solemn reminder of the
sacrifice of the martyrs who died for the country in the freedom movement of
India.
To mark the importance
of this day, Parade was held by Rehab team members, volunteers, and students of
Rehab Tuition Centre. Children of Gourhar, Jasola Vihar, Nizamudheen Colony,
Nandamuri Nagar, Holagunda, Vallinokkam and Solva were actively involved.
Children of Gourhar
performed different cultural programmes. To motivate the children, Village Head
distributed awards for ‘Best Student’, ‘Best Sports’, and ‘Best Individual’ for
their performance.
On the occasion, Flag
hosting was done by Niyas Ahmad, Tehsildar of Holagunda Village, A.P. During
the programme, Rajashekar Goudu, Village Revenue Officer, lukman Supply Officer, vakeel ismail, Ex Ward Member, 60 students and 30
Community People were participated. Prizes were distributed to the children for
the above selected categories with the same motto.
At Nizamudheen Colony,
Republic Day was celebrated at Community Centre of Rehab India Foundation. In
this programme, 120 students, 60 community people were actively involved.
As far as West Belgal
is concerned, Republic Day was celebrated at Solva Village of the State. Street
Plays and different cultural programmes were organized at the Rehab Community
Centre.
